In the future, gods don’t descend from the heavens—they pilot war machines.

The year is 2848. Wars aren’t won by nations—they’re brokered by corporations. A.R.M.S. pilots, warriors bound to towering mechs with the firepower of gods, fight for fame, fortune, and survival in the ruthless chaos of Free Space.

Cameron Pellyn was born a prince.

​Now he's nothing but an exile with a stolen name and a death warrant hanging over his head. Betrayed by the very people who raised him, he has only one shot at reclaiming his life: enter the mercenary arena and rise through the ranks of A.R.M.S. combat.

But nothing about surviving as a rookie pilot is easy.

The battlefield is brutal, his mech is a relic, and his only ally is Logan—an ex-Guard Captain with a sharp tongue and a buried past.

To endure, Cameron must become more than a pilot.

He must become a weapon.

As war looms and an old enemy resurfaces, Cameron is forced to choose: cling to the past—or forge a new future in fire and steel.

Perfect for fans of Gundam, Iron Widow, Red Rising, and The Expanse.
  • Gritty mech warfare
  • High-stakes space opera
  • Weak-to-strong character arc
  • Morally gray decisions
  • Political intrigue, personal vengeance, and found family
The Hounds of Orion are ready for war.
And Cameron Ket is done running.
